Still powered by song after ‘Glee’
Matthew Morrison is singing Broadway hits on tour and hoping for his dream role.
A pained frown raced along Matthew Morrison’s brow. This wasn’t the terrorized expression of horror we recall from the hit TV show “Glee” when his Mr. Schuester was under attack by his archenemy gym coach, played by Jane Lynch. Nor the exaggerated, fierce scowl he sported recently on a Broadway stage, clashing with Kelsey Grammer’s Capt. Hook in “Finding Neverland.”
